Battery capacity depends on your daily power use, backup goals, and system voltage. Use the formula: Total Wh ÷ DoD ÷ Voltage = Required Ah. Consider inefficiencies and future power needs when sizing. Lithium batteries are best for longevity; lead-acid is budget-friendly. Use a battery bank size calculator and solar. . Power (in watts) equals voltage (in volts) multiplied by current (in amps). With most 80-watt solar panels typically operating at around 17 volts, dividing the power output by the voltage gives the approximate current output. 0 amps of current under optimal sunlight conditions, 2.
